Understanding the Mechanics of the Crash Game
The fundamental principle behind the crash game is a provably fair system, meaning the outcome of each round is demonstrably random and unbiased. This transparency is crucial for building trust with players and ensuring the integrity of the game. Most platforms utilize a cryptographic algorithm that generates a random “seed” value before each round. This seed is then used to determine the point at which the multiplier will crash. Players can often verify the fairness of each round by independently checking the seed and the algorithm used. This offers a level of accountability not found in traditional casino games, adding to the appeal for discerning players. Martingale and Anti-Martingale Systems
Two commonly discussed betting systems in the context of crash games are the Martingale and Anti-Martingale. The Martingale system involves doubling your bet after each loss, aiming to recoup previous losses with a single win. This can be effective in the short term, but it requires a substantial bankroll to withstand potential losing streaks, and there’s always the risk of reaching the table's maximum bet limit. The Anti-Martingale system, conversely, involves increasing your bet after each win and decreasing it after each loss. This approach can capitalize on winning streaks but offers less protection during losing streaks. Both systems are risky and should be approached with caution, understanding that they do not guarantee profits. Responsible gameplay is paramount when utilizing any betting system.

Managing Risk and Bankroll
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most crucial aspect of playing the crash game. The game's inherent volatility means that losing streaks are inevitable. Therefore, it’s essential to allocate a specific portion of your gaming funds to the crash game and to avoid betting more than you can afford to lose. A common rule of thumb is to allocate no more than 1-5% of your total bankroll to each bet. This helps to preserve your capital and allows you to weather periods of unfavorable outcomes. Consistently applying this principle is vital for long-term sustainability. Understanding your risk tolerance is also paramount; some players are comfortable with higher levels of risk in pursuit of larger rewards, while others prefer a more conservative approach.
Calculating Optimal Bet Size
Determining the optimal bet size involves considering your bankroll, risk tolerance, and the game’s volatility. A conservative approach would involve calculating the percentage of your bankroll you are willing to risk per bet. For example, if you have a bankroll of £100 and are willing to risk 2% per bet, your initial bet size would be £2. From there, you can adjust your bet size based on your wins and losses, always adhering to your predetermined risk parameters. It's important to remember that even with a well-calculated bet size, losses can still occur. The aim is not to eliminate risk entirely, but to manage it effectively and protect your overall bankroll. A spreadsheet can be a useful tool for tracking bets and monitoring bankroll fluctuations.

The Psychological Aspects of Crash Gaming
The crash game is not merely a game of chance; it’s also a psychological battle. The constant rise in the multiplier triggers a dopamine rush, creating a sense of excitement and anticipation. This can lead to impulsive decision-making and a tendency to chase losses, as players become fixated on the potential for a large payout. Recognizing these psychological tendencies is crucial for maintaining control and avoiding reckless behavior. It is easy to get caught up in the moment, especially during winning streaks, but it’s vital to remain rational and stick to your pre-defined strategy. Mindful gaming, being aware of your emotional state, is an essential component of responsible gameplay.
